Resumo: The use of certain spa for curative effect has known for a long time. In this dissertation, we ll establish connection between mineral water s appliance for therapeutic aim and the legislation of 1945 Código de Águas Minerais , to understand if this legislation came to control a previous use, regarding the knowledge moves through the time, to answer each social context question. This legislation valid until our days is useful to consider water as mineral due to its curative effects (used or not), associated with the chemical composition. In this research, we ll present the mineral water s work in Brazil in XX century (between 1930 1970) by Termas de Ibirá study, showing, with some examples, the therapeutic properties of its mineral water. We also introduce how the chemical knowledge can change through the time, in the determination of chemical composition of mineral water, and the institutions that achieved chemical analysis of this water, as well some methods used by them. Although mineral water s composition doesn t modifie through the time, our search also made possible to verify different prescriptions by distinct health professionals in the same thermae
